Brass Come Back Late to Clip Tarantulas
New Orleans Brass starter LaTroy Hawkins was locked-in. He led his team to a win over the Tucson Tarantulas, 5-3. New Orleans reliever Brent Knackert picked up the win, upping his record to 3-0. Ron Mahay absorbed the loss. Earning his 10th save of the year was Mark Brandenburg.

A decisive at-bat came in the top of the eighth inning. With the bases empty, the batter, Mike R. Fitzgerald, hit a solo home run. It made the score 4-3, New Orleans, and helped them go on to win.

"We did a lot of things right," said Hawkins.

The Brass have an impressive 19-9 record.
